How to Select Touch Screens for Outdoor Applications

1.Protection Grade and Sealing (Basic Essentials)
  • Minimum IP Rating: Directly exposed to wind, rain, dust and sand outdoors, touch screens must reach
IP65 or above. Choose IP66/IP67 for heavy rain and coastal environments. It features fully dustproof enclosed structure, resistance to water spray from all directions and short-term water immersion. 
  • Sealing Structure: Seal module edges tightly with waterproof silicone rings, labyrinth seals and waterproof adhesive. Equip cable outlets with waterproof cable glands and potting sealant to prevent moisture ingress, circuit short circuits and line corrosion.
  • Installation Inclination: Install vertically or tilt upward at an angle of no less than 45° for smooth rainwater drainage. Horizontal placement is strictly prohibited, as accumulated water and water film will cause ghost touch, false touch and touch drift.
  • Anti-condensation: Adopt full lamination process to eliminate air gaps and avoid fogging caused by temperature difference. Equip breathable waterproof membranes to balance internal and external air pressure, preventing condensation from eroding ITO circuits.

2. Temperature, Humidity and High & Low Temperature Protection
Operating Temperature Range: Ordinary indoor touch screens (0~40℃) are not applicable outdoors. Select industrial wide-temperature modules supporting -30℃~70/85℃, which adapt to extreme temperatures across all seasons nationwide.

High Temperature Sun Exposure Protection: Built-in active heat dissipation, heat pipes, temperature-controlled fans and overheating frequency reduction protection prevent backlight aging, IC burnout and touch drift.

Install sun visors or outer shields on the complete unit to reduce direct sunlight exposure. Adopt heat-dissipating metal materials for the enclosure.

Low Temperature Anti-freezing: Enable low-temperature touch compensation algorithm to boost signal gain, avoiding cold failure and slow response.

Install low-temperature heating films when necessary to ensure normal startup in frigid environments.

Humidity & Coastal Salt Spray Resistance: Adapt to long-term outdoor humidity of 5%~95% non-condensing environment. Adopt 316 stainless steel, anti-corrosion coating and anti-salt spray film for coastal areas to avoid rusting of metal pins and flexible cables.

3. Strong Light, UV Resistance and Optical Adaptation (Core for Outdoor Visibility)
Brightness Requirement: To ensure visibility under direct sunlight, the brightness shall be no less than 1000 nits; 1500~2000 nits is recommended for intense sunlight scenarios.

Surface Coating: Must adopt AG anti-glare, AF oil-repellent hydrophobic and UV anti-aging coatings. It effectively prevents light reflection, fingerprint and rainwater adhesion, as well as UV-induced yellowing and aging.

Glass Selection: Use thickened chemically strengthened tempered glass with thickness of 1.8~3mm and hardness ≥8H, which resists gravel impact, scratches and external damage.

Lamination Method: Adopt full optical bonding instead of frame bonding, eliminating air layer reflection, temperature difference condensation and poor visual performance.

Front Cover Blackening Process: Prioritize high-temperature ceramic ink printing or low-temperature UV-resistant ink printing. Ordinary low-temperature ink will peel off after long-term exposure to strong sunlight.

4. Exclusive Troubleshooting for Capacitive Touch Abnormalities
Rain & Water Touch Suppression: Rainwater, wet hands and water film on screen cause ghost points, cursor drift and unresponsiveness. Enable firmware-based waterproof touch algorithm, dynamic baseline calibration and water shielding threshold.

Glove Compatibility: For outdoor public scenarios, support operation with thin gloves and wet hands by adjusting touch sensitivity and recognition threshold.

ESD Anti-static Protection: Severe static electricity is generated by wind-sand friction and human body outdoors. Ensure reliable module grounding and full-link ESD protection, with stable grounding for power supply and enclosure, to avoid IC breakdown and touch disorder.

EMC Electromagnetic Interference Resistance: Keep away from high-voltage cables and signal base stations. Adopt shielded wiring and differential routing to prevent touch drift caused by electromagnetic interference.

5. Installation Wiring & Structural Protection
Body Enclosure: Integrated aluminum alloy frame features anti-deformation, good heat dissipation and impact resistance with reinforced corners.

FPC Cable Protection: Wrap flexible cables with heat-insulated and waterproof sleeves, follow standard bending radius to avoid pulling damage, high-temperature aging and water ingress.

Grounding Specification: Implement single-point common grounding for touch layer, shielding layer and metal casing to reduce static electricity and interference.

Anti-damage Design: Equip protective frames and anti-pry structures for public outdoor use, preventing the module from being hit and scratched by hard objects.

6. Daily Use & Maintenance Specifications
Cleaning: Only use dry microfiber cloth; adopt neutral pure water as cleaning liquid. Never spray liquid directly on the screen, and prohibit alcohol and acetone to prevent corrosion on coating and ITO layer.

No hard object contact: Scratches from keys, knives and other hard items will cause permanent damage to the glass and sensing layer.

Regular inspection: Check for cracked sealing strips, condensation, loose cables and abnormal heat dissipation; regularly remove salt spray and dust in coastal areas.

Storage & Transportation: Keep within standard temperature and humidity range, use anti-static packaging, store vertically, avoid direct sunlight and heavy stacking.
FAQ
1.Q: Can it work normally on rainy days and with wet hands?
A: Yes, it is equipped with professional water touch suppression algorithm and dynamic baseline calibration, effectively eliminating ghost touches and unresponsive issues caused by water film and wet hands.

2.Q: Is the front glass scratch-resistant enough for outdoor public use?
A: Adopt 1.8-3mm thickened chemically strengthened tempered glass with hardness up to 8H, capable of resisting daily scratch, gravel impact and external force damage.

3.Q: Why choose full optical bonding instead of frame bonding?
A: Full bonding removes air layer, avoids reflection and condensation caused by temperature difference, and greatly improves outdoor visual effect and display uniformity.

4.Q: Does the product have strong anti-interference and anti-static ability?
A: It adopts full-link ESD protection and EMC electromagnetic shielding design, with standard single-point grounding, effectively resisting static electricity and surrounding electromagnetic interference.

5.Q: What are the correct ways for daily cleaning and maintenance?
A: Wipe with dry microfiber cloth and neutral pure water only, never use alcohol or corrosive solvents; conduct regular inspection, and do not touch the screen with hard objects.
